  • Touch screen is cool. 20X's Zoom

    I like the touch screen feature. Once you figure out how to customize the menu to the features you would most like use then it's pretty easy to adjust the settings for different lighting conditions. Only takes about 2or 3 minutes to finalize the dvd and about 10 seconds or less to unfinalize it. When I bought the camera (used) it didn't come with any software and I haven't had time to download the driver from the internet. Once I do I'll be able to do some editing on the computer. The one thing I don't like is that if you just got done recording a scene you can immediately delete it if you want but you can't go back an delete any scenes prior to the last one.   • Nice camcorder

    I have never used/purchased a mini camcorder before. This one was very easy to setup and understand. The video quality seems to be very good. I have not used the camera/photo option yet. The DVD played on my DVD player without any problem. The touch screen menu is super easy to use. I don't plan on editing my video's, or downloading them onto my PC, so I went with this model. Pretty much, using a DVD-R, it's load, record, finalize. That's it. Then pop it into your DVD player to watch. I guess the limitation is only 30 minutes of recording time on the DVD, but that's plenty for me. Cost of the DVD-R's is about $3.00 each, so that is bearable for me as well.
